Output 6aacc88a759d26e398578cf777e2a940dc4d4e100d9d85df6c3b8352533e1e63:8

value
37756672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6acdf08825547e73f7f1f1b462250a7a604229ab OP_EQUAL
address
MHdtZhNe1a4YNXoXoApiE17G5ge3ap8pQK
transaction
6aacc88a759d26e398578cf777e2a940dc4d4e100d9d85df6c3b8352533e1e63
spent
true